    The reimbursement ratio of NCMS is generally about 30%-40% for inter-provincial medical treatment, and the reimbursement ratio in Anhui Province is referred to below:

    1. For hospitalization outside the province and city**, the starting line of the medical erection institution in the city will be doubled, and the reimbursement ratio will be reduced by 10%;

    2. For hospitalization in hospitals outside the province, the starting line is calculated at 20% of the total hospitalization cost of the grade (the minimum is 2,000 yuan, the maximum is 10,000 yuan), and the reimbursement ratio is 55%. If you are hospitalized in another place without referral**, the reimbursement rate will be reduced by another 10%.

    Generally speaking, the reimbursement ratio for medical treatment in other places in the province is about 70%, while the reimbursement ratio for medical treatment in other places across provinces is about 60%. However, the specific reimbursement ratio needs to be determined according to the specific local policies and regulations.

    The reimbursement ratio for medical treatment in other places refers to the part reimbursed in the medical insurance**, and the remaining part needs to be borne by the individual. For reimbursement of medical treatment in other places, relevant reimbursement materials need to be provided, such as medical invoices, outpatient medical records, etc. In some areas, there will also be a direct settlement service for medical treatment in other places, that is, when you are treated in a remote hospital, you will directly use your medical insurance card for settlement, and you will be reimbursed if you don't need to pay the expenses first.

    The calculation of the reimbursement ratio for medical treatment in other places will also be affected by factors such as the hospital where the medical treatment is provided.
